    Choosing the Right Blackstone Griddle

    Select a Blackstone griddle with sufficient cooking space. Models with a cooking surface of at least 28 inches provide ample room for multiple pizzas. Look for features like adjustable heat controls, as they allow for better temperature management. The ability to reach high temperatures quickly is crucial for achieving that perfect crispy crust. Additionally, consider a model with side shelves for extra prep space and tool storage.

    Key Ingredients for Pizza

    Use fresh, high-quality ingredients for the best flavor. Here’s a list of the essentials:

    • Pizza Dough: Opt for either store-bought dough or make your own with flour, water, yeast, and salt. Aim for a dough that stretches easily without tearing.
    • Pizza Sauce: Use traditional tomato sauce or your choice of alternatives, like pesto or barbecue sauce. Ensure it doesn’t add excess moisture.
    • Cheese: Mozzarella is the classic choice, but mix in provolone, parmesan, or cheddar for added flavor. Shredded cheese melts evenly.
    • Toppings: Choose your favorite toppings. Options include pepperoni, vegetables, fresh basil, and olives. Avoid overloading the pizza to ensure even cooking.
    • Olive Oil: Brush a light layer on the griddle surface and the dough for better browning and flavor.

    Step-by-Step Cooking Instructions

    Follow these simple steps to create delicious pizza on your Blackstone griddle.

    Preparing the Dough

    1. Choose fresh pizza dough. You can opt for store-bought or make your own at home.
    2. Let the dough rest for about 30 minutes at room temperature. This makes it easier to stretch.
    3. Lightly flour your surface and roll or stretch the dough into your desired shape. Aim for a thickness of around ¼ inch for a crispy crust.
    4. Transfer the shaped dough onto a pizza peel or cutting board dusted with flour to prevent sticking.

    Topping Your Pizza

    1. Spread your favorite pizza sauce evenly over the dough, leaving a small edge for the crust.
    2. Sprinkle a generous amount of shredded cheese over the sauce. Mozzarella is a popular choice, but feel free to mix in other cheeses for added flavor.
    3. Add your preferred toppings, such as pepperoni, veggies, or cooked meats. Don’t overload to ensure even cooking.
    4. Drizzle a small amount of olive oil over the toppings for extra flavor.
    1. Preheat the Blackstone griddle on high for about 10 minutes. Use the built-in thermometer to check for optimal temperature (around 500°F).
    2. Carefully slide your assembled pizza from the peel onto the griddle.
    3. Close the lid and cook for approximately 5-8 minutes. Check occasionally to ensure even cooking. You’ll see the crust puff up and the cheese melt.
    4. Once ready, use a spatula to carefully lift the pizza off. Allow it to cool for a minute before slicing.
    5. Serve hot and enjoy your tasty griddled pizza!

    Temperature Control

    Manage your griddle’s temperature for optimal cooking. Preheat the griddle to a setting between 450°F and 500°F for the best crust. Use a built-in thermometer or an infrared thermometer to check the surface temperature. Such precision ensures that the pizza cooks evenly. If the heat is too low, the crust may become soggy; too high, and it can burn before toppings cook.

    • Overloading Toppings: Limit toppings to maintain even cooking. Stick with three to four ingredients for perfect results.
    • Using Cold Dough: Let your dough come to room temperature before shaping. Cold dough can lead to a tough crust.
    • Checking for Doneness: Monitor your pizza closely. Aim for a golden-brown crust with melted cheese, typically within 5-8 minutes of cooking.
    • Not Using Olive Oil: Brush the griddle and the crust lightly with olive oil. This step enhances crispiness and prevents sticking.

    How do I prevent a soggy pizza crust when using a griddle?

    To prevent a soggy pizza crust on a griddle, ensure the griddle is preheated to a high temperature (between 450°F and 500°F) before placing the pizza. Avoid overloading the pizza with toppings, and brush both the griddle and the crust with olive oil for added crispness.

    What essential tools do I need for making pizza on a Blackstone griddle?

    Essential tools for cooking pizza on a Blackstone griddle include a pizza stone, pizza peel, and a spatula. These tools help in managing pizza placement, cooking, and serving for the best results.
